LOOP by Tanya-Loretta Dee

10 — 29 November, Theatre503

Bex is fucking obsessed! She can’t get James out of her head. In the Peckham party shop where she twists balloon animals for minimum wage, all she can think about is him.

The locket her Mother gave to her – the day she started her period – clings like a curse, whispering warnings that Bex constantly ignores. As her grip on reality unravels, Bex circles the same stories about wolves, witches and wanking, each one darker than the last. Will she ever break the loop? Or will she disappear into fantasy forever? LOOP is a chilling psychological folktale that drags us kicking and screaming into the horrors of an obsessive mind. What happens when you can’t tell yourself the truth? What happens when the story threatens to swallow you whole?

Described as a ’surreal one-woman fever dream’. Part folk-tale, part horror, this is a love story that dives into the heart of obsessive desire, limerence, and the intoxicating pull of fantasy and unreality.
